### v7.1.0 — Changed defaults

Soft deletes are now the default for the Ordavia orders table. Rows are no longer removed; instead, a deletion timestamp is set and rows are excluded from standard queries. Contractors writing reports must filter on that column explicitly, since raw table scans will include tombstoned rows. The purge worker honors the following values.

deployment values, yahag-tawef:
ZORWYN_HOST=zorwyn.tolvaqlabs.internal
ZORWYN_PORT=9300

Heads up, support folks: if Quillhop builds fail with "incompatible schema" on the events topic, it's usually the Braidcast schema registry caching a stale version. Don't roll back — just retrigger the registry sync job and rerun CI. If it fails twice, the producer really did break compatibility; escalate to the Fenwick team. Reference the token below when filing.

build token for tawip-yageg: htk9_92ac43d42

Subject: Quickstore 4.2 — bloom filter now fronts the KV layer

Plugin authors: starting with this release, Quickstore places a bloom filter ahead of the key-value store. Negative lookups return faster; false positives fall through safely. No API changes are required on your side. Verify your plugin against the staging build referenced below.

session token of fahif-tadup = htk3_9c7

## RotorVault Secrets-Rotation Utility

RotorVault rotates service credentials on a schedule you define per namespace — no more quarterly spreadsheet panic. Each rotation run is atomic: new secret minted, consumers notified via the Fanout hook, old secret revoked after the grace window. For the security review, the relevant bits are the audit log (`/v1/rotations/audit`) and the dual-control approval flow for manual rotations. Calls to the rotation API authenticate with the internal key below.

gateway credential: kto23_LX9A4ys6i4nzHtpOLNLodKK